python开发界面用哪个
-
在python开发界面中,常用的开发环境有多种选择,具体使用哪个取决于个人需求和偏好。以下是几个常见的python开发界面:
1. PyCharm(适用于专业开发):
PyCharm是一款功能强大的集成开发环境(IDE),专为Python开发而设计。它具有强大的代码编辑和调试功能,自动代码补全和错误检查等。PyCharm还提供了许多其他功能,如版本控制、测试、代码分析等。2. Jupyter Notebook(适用于数据科学和机器学习):
Jupyter Notebook是一个开源Web应用程序,用于创建和共享文档,其中可以包含实时代码、方程式、可视化和文本。它对于数据科学和机器学习的初学者和专业人士来说非常有用,可以交互式地编写和运行代码,并即时查看结果。3. Visual Studio Code(适用于轻量级开发):
Visual Studio Code是一款跨平台的轻量级代码编辑器,它支持多种编程语言,包括Python。它具有高度可定制性和扩展性,可以通过安装各种插件来增加功能。Visual Studio Code还提供了内置的调试器和版本控制等功能。4. PyScripter(适用于初学者):
PyScripter是一款简单易用的Python集成开发环境,适用于初学者。它具有直观的用户界面和基本的代码编辑和调试功能。PyScripter还提供了逐步执行和变量监视等辅助调试功能,有助于初学者理解和调试代码。需要注意的是,以上只是一些常见的python开发界面,实际上还有许多其他选择,如Spyder、IDLE等。选择哪个开发界面取决于个人的偏好和项目需求。建议根据自身情况进行尝试和比较,找到最适合自己的python开发界面。
2年前 -
在Python开发界面中,常用的开发工具有多种选择。以下是五个常见的Python开发界面:
1. PyCharm:
PyCharm是目前最流行的Python集成开发环境(IDE),由JetBrains开发。它提供了丰富的功能和工具,如代码自动补全、调试器、版本控制、单元测试和代码跳转等。PyCharm还支持多种框架和库,如Django和Flask,使开发者能够更轻松地开发和维护Python应用程序。2. Visual Studio Code:
Visual Studio Code是一个轻量级的开源代码编辑器,由微软开发。它拥有强大的插件系统,可以扩展其功能。对于Python开发,可以添加各种插件来提供代码提示、调试功能等。Visual Studio Code还具有集成的终端窗口,可以在同一个界面中执行Python脚本。3. Jupyter Notebook:
Jupyter Notebook是一个基于Web的交互式开发环境,支持多种编程语言,包括Python。它将代码和可视化结果组合在一起,使得开发者能够更加直观地进行代码编写和数据分析。Jupyter Notebook还支持Markdown和LaTeX语法,可以创建丰富的文档。4. Spyder:
Spyder是一个专为科学计算和数据分析而设计的Python开发环境。它集成了许多科学计算库,如NumPy和Pandas,并提供了交互式的控制台和变量查看器。Spyder的界面类似于MATLAB,使得科学计算和数据分析变得更加简单和直观。5. Sublime Text:
Sublime Text是一个轻量级的代码编辑器,拥有丰富的插件生态系统。虽然不是专门为Python开发设计的,但它支持多种编程语言,并且可以通过插件来添加Python开发所需的功能。Sublime Text具有快速的搜索和替换功能,以及自定义快捷键和代码片段,使开发变得更加高效。综上所述,Python开发界面的选择取决于开发者的需求和个人偏好。无论选择哪个界面,都可以提高开发效率和代码质量。
2年前 -
在Python开发界面方面,常见的选择包括命令行界面(CLI)、图形用户界面(GUI)、集成开发环境(IDE)以及Web界面等。不同的开发需求和个人喜好会决定开发者使用的界面。下面我们将分别介绍几种常见的Python开发界面及其操作流程。
1. 命令行界面(CLI)
命令行界面是最基础的开发界面,通过在终端窗口输入命令来与程序进行交互。在Python中,开发者可以使用内置的`input`函数接收用户输入,然后利用条件语句和循环语句进行处理。CLI的操作流程主要包括以下几步:
1. 打开终端窗口,进入Python解释器环境。
2. 编写Python程序代码,并保存为.py文件。
3. 在终端窗口中使用`python`命令运行程序,可通过`python 文件名.py`的格式执行。2. 图形用户界面(GUI)
图形用户界面是一种通过图形元素(按钮、文本框、菜单等)与用户进行交互的界面。Python中常用的GUI库包括Tkinter、PyQt、wxPython等。使用GUI开发界面的操作流程如下:
1. 安装所需的GUI库,如Tkinter可以在Python标准库中直接使用。
2. 导入所需的库模块,并创建GUI窗口对象。
3. 在窗口对象中添加各种图形组件,如按钮、文本框等。
4. 通过编写相应的回调函数来处理用户交互事件。
5. 运行程序,启动GUI界面。3. 集成开发环境(IDE)
集成开发环境是一种集成了编辑器、调试器、编译器等开发工具的软件。常见的Python集成开发环境有PyCharm、Visual Studio Code、Spyder等。使用IDE可以提供丰富的开发功能,提高开发效率。使用集成开发环境进行Python开发的操作流程如下:
1. 安装所选的IDE,并配置Python解释器。
2. 创建新项目或打开现有项目。
3. 在编辑器中编写Python代码,可以进行自动补全、语法检查等操作。
4. 运行程序,调试代码,并查看运行结果和调试信息。4. Web界面
Web界面是一种基于浏览器的开发界面。Python提供了多个Web框架,如Django、Flask、Tornado等,开发者可以选择适合自己项目需求的框架进行开发。使用Web界面进行Python开发的操作流程如下:
1. 安装所选的Web框架,如通过pip安装Django包。
2. 创建Web项目,框架会提供相应的工具和命令来快速生成基础文件和目录结构。
3. 编写视图函数、模板、URLs等文件,完成网页的逻辑和显示。
4. 运行Web服务器,通过浏览器访问网站,并进行交互和测试。以上是几种常见的Python开发界面及其操作流程的简要介绍。开发者可以根据项目需求和个人喜好选择合适的界面进行开发。
2年前